Where To Find The Fish Monk

Those who have already seized the Alder Windmill have a short distance to travel. The Fish Monk is a little distance to the northeast of that spot. He’ll have an exclamation mark on the map when he’s available, suggesting that he’s available to speak with.

He’s seated on a bench near to a hut that houses a vendor. He never gets up or wanders about, so players never have to worry about losing track of him. He’s also in a safe zone, so there’s no risk of zombies killing him and causing the task to fail.

Do Not Click The White Dialogue Options

Among the various issues that the game requires, some fans may believe that the dialogue wheel requires more alternatives. Others advocate for less talk and more action. In this case, having fewer options would have made the assignment much easier.

White dialogue options usually request further information, but for some reason, Aiden chastises the poor man and quits the chat with the Fish Monk. Don’t worry, the objective succeeds; but, the dialogue must be restarted.

Listen To His Tale

It’s all smooth sailing from here on out. Gamers simply need to use the yellow chat options to ask the Fish Monk more questions. It’s a long, moving storey about a man, his fish, his emotions, and what he’s learnt about the world.

The mission and the dialogue are the same thing. The sole requirement for players is that they listen to the entire game before moving on to the next stage. What appears to be a natural vengeance expedition is actually a listening and learning quest.
